A teen walks the streets of Antigua, carrying a myriad of colourful toys which he offers to passersby. Dolls, animals and carts tempt toddlers, and bright foam rubber snakes and lizards appeal to older children. "I depict a young vendor, one of many who take advantage of vacation days during the Holy Week observances," Mario Sergio Aviles says. Although he offers fun and happiness, the weary boy seems thoughtful. His family relies on his help to meet day-to-day expenses.
Titled "William y las iguanas" in Spanish.
